3 hours ago, Forge said:

Seth walder and ESPN have tracked it for a couple of years. Previously, Bosa hasn't been doubled a ton. I'm pretty sure ebukam got doubled last year more than Bosa. 

Different this year. He's at the top of some of the premiere pass rushers, tied with Parsons in terms of pass rush, but those guys are still performing. Bosa has a pretty soft win rate, tbh.  I'm not a huge fan of win rate being all encompassing (some of the data is mostly a who cares scenario where they aren't impacting the play)

Cool it's not just my feelings, I really think it is because we are stunting less, so it is easier to just double down the two best guys every play.  We tried to get Ekubam and McGill double teamed last year, to free up the other guys.  Creative alignments create single teams for Bosa, and single teams on Bosa are better than double teams.

Bosa doesn't look as good this year, but nothing is quite clicking like it was in prior seasons.  I think just getting back to pressure looks on most passing downs would go a long way.  It's not about sending pressure, it's about manipulating the offensive line play calls to create space for our four linemen.  It's like we have gone from seeing the game in 3-d with Ryans, to on paper with Wilks.
